#include "consoleprocess.h"
#include <QtCore/QCoreApplication>
#include <QtCore/QTemporaryFile>
#include <QtNetwork/QLocalSocket>
#include <sys/stat.h>
#include <sys/types.h>
#include <errno.h>
#include <string.h>
#include <unistd.h>
using namespace Core::Utils;
ConsoleProcess::ConsoleProcess(QObject *parent)
: QObject(parent)
{
m_debug = false;
m_appPid = 0;
m_stubSocket = 0;
connect(&m_stubServer, SIGNAL(newConnection()), SLOT(stubConnectionAvailable()));
m_process.setProcessChannelMode(QProcess::ForwardedChannels);
connect(&m_process, SIGNAL(finished(int, QProcess::ExitStatus)),
SLOT(stubExited()));
}
ConsoleProcess::~ConsoleProcess()
{
stop();
}
bool ConsoleProcess::start(const QString &program, const QStringList &args)
{
if (isRunning())
return false;
QString err = stubServerListen();
if (!err.isEmpty()) {
emit processError(tr("Cannot set up comm channel: %1").arg(err));
return false;
}
QStringList xtermArgs;
xtermArgs << "-e"
#ifdef Q_OS_MAC
<< (QCoreApplication::applicationDirPath() + "/../Resources/qtcreator_process_stub")
#else
<< (QCoreApplication::applicationDirPath() + "/qtcreator_process_stub")
#endif
<< (m_debug ? "debug" : "exec")
<< m_stubServer.fullServerName()
<< tr("Press <RETURN> to close this window...")
<< workingDirectory() << environment() << ""
<< program << args;
m_process.start(QLatin1String("xterm"), xtermArgs);
if (!m_process.waitForStarted()) {
stubServerShutdown();
emit processError(tr("Cannot start console emulator xterm."));
return false;
}
m_executable = program;
emit wrapperStarted();
return true;
}
void ConsoleProcess::stop()
{
if (!isRunning())
return;
stubServerShutdown();
m_appPid = 0;
m_process.terminate();
if (!m_process.waitForFinished(1000))
m_process.kill();
m_process.waitForFinished();
}
bool ConsoleProcess::isRunning() const
{
return m_process.state() != QProcess::NotRunning;
}
QString ConsoleProcess::stubServerListen()
{
// We need to put the socket in a private directory, as some systems simply do not
// check the file permissions of sockets.
QString stubFifoDir;
forever {
{
QTemporaryFile tf;
if (!tf.open())
return tr("Cannot create temporary file: %2").arg(tf.errorString());
stubFifoDir = QFile::encodeName(tf.fileName());
}
// By now the temp file was deleted again
m_stubServerDir = QFile::encodeName(stubFifoDir);
if (!::mkdir(m_stubServerDir.constData(), 0700))
break;
if (errno != EEXIST)
return tr("Cannot create temporary directory %1: %2").arg(stubFifoDir, strerror(errno));
}
QString stubServer = stubFifoDir + "/stub-socket";
if (!m_stubServer.listen(stubServer)) {
::rmdir(m_stubServerDir.constData());
return tr("Cannot create socket %1: %2").arg(stubServer, m_stubServer.errorString());
}
return QString();
}
void ConsoleProcess::stubServerShutdown()
{
delete m_stubSocket;
m_stubSocket = 0;
if (m_stubServer.isListening()) {
m_stubServer.close();
::rmdir(m_stubServerDir.constData());
}
}
void ConsoleProcess::stubConnectionAvailable()
{
m_stubSocket = m_stubServer.nextPendingConnection();
connect(m_stubSocket, SIGNAL(readyRead()), SLOT(readStubOutput()));
}
static QString errorMsg(int code)
{
return QString::fromLocal8Bit(strerror(code));
}
void ConsoleProcess::readStubOutput()
{
while (m_stubSocket->canReadLine()) {
QByteArray out = m_stubSocket->readLine();
out.chop(1); // \n
if (out.startsWith("err:chdir ")) {
emit processError(tr("Cannot change to working directory %1: %2")
.arg(workingDirectory(), errorMsg(out.mid(10).toInt())));
} else if (out.startsWith("err:exec ")) {
emit processError(tr("Cannot execute %1: %2")
.arg(m_executable, errorMsg(out.mid(9).toInt())));
} else if (out.startsWith("pid ")) {
m_appPid = out.mid(4).toInt();
emit processStarted();
} else if (out.startsWith("exit ")) {
m_appStatus = QProcess::NormalExit;
m_appCode = out.mid(5).toInt();
m_appPid = 0;
emit processStopped();
} else if (out.startsWith("crash ")) {
m_appStatus = QProcess::CrashExit;
m_appCode = out.mid(6).toInt();
m_appPid = 0;
emit processStopped();
} else {
emit processError(tr("Unexpected output from helper program."));
m_process.terminate();
break;
}
}
}
void ConsoleProcess::stubExited()
{
// The stub exit might get noticed before we read the error status.
if (m_stubSocket && m_stubSocket->state() == QLocalSocket::ConnectedState)
m_stubSocket->waitForDisconnected();
stubServerShutdown();
if (m_appPid) {
m_appStatus = QProcess::CrashExit;
m_appCode = -1;
m_appPid = 0;
emit processStopped(); // Maybe it actually did not, but keep state consistent
}
emit wrapperStopped();
}
